A fast-paced, 72-hour plunge into Morocco's greatest historical capitals. Trace the Atlantic coast to Rabat, dive into the medieval labyrinth of Fes, and walk the ancient Roman streets of Volubilis.
Arriving in Tangier from Europe offers the perfect opportunity to uncover thousands of years of North African history in a matter of days. "The Northern Imperial Heritage" tour bypasses the long desert drives in favor of a culturally rich, highly focused circuit through Morocco's northern powerhouses. You will explore the elegant political capital of Rabat, spend a full day wandering the world's largest car-free medina alongside a Fes historian, and step back two millennia into the remarkably preserved mosaics of the Roman Empire at Volubilis. It is an immersive, luxurious, and highly efficient way to experience Morocco's royal past.
Your private driver will greet you at the Tangier ferry port, airport, or your hotel. We immediately hop onto the modern coastal highway, driving south toward Morocco's elegant capital city, Rabat. Here, you will stretch your legs exploring the 12th-century Hassan Tower, the Mausoleum of Mohammed V, and the picturesque, blue-and-white Kasbah of the Udayas overlooking the Atlantic. After lunch in the capital, we journey inland through fertile agricultural plains, arriving in the spiritual epicenter of Fes in the late afternoon. You will check into your luxury riad tucked away in the ancient medina.
After breakfast, you will meet your private, official local historian for an immersive morning walking tour of Fes el-Bali—a UNESCO World Heritage site featuring over 9,000 winding alleys. You will witness centuries-old traditions at the iconic Chouara Tanneries, admire the intricate zellige tilework of the Bou Inania Madrasa, and see the ancient Al Quaraouiyine University. After marveling at the golden gates of the Royal Palace, the afternoon is yours to relax at your riad or hunt for artisan treasures in the bustling souks.
We depart Fes in the morning, driving through the rolling hills and olive groves to reach Volubilis, the most important Roman archaeological site in Morocco. You will have time to wander among the ancient basilicas, triumphal arches, and incredibly preserved floor mosaics dating back to the 3rd century. Afterward, we continue our journey north, passing through the scenic foothills of the Rif Mountains, completing our loop back to Tangier. Your driver will drop you off at the ferry port, airport, or your onward accommodation with plenty of time for your evening departure.
